The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Warrington local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three 8 WOODBRIDGE CLOSE sales between July 1996 and October 2018 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the January 2014 sale was for 54%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 54% above the HPI over time, until the October 2018 sale, which was also at 54% above the HPI.

The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of 8 WOODBRIDGE CLOSE).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
